Output 106674001ecbe565a4a1e0b1c628ebfa800886310a556f72620abe3f1acf01d2:1

value
84995
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9f43b1fc628158af6a0da91d261ef2e29714e75e OP_EQUAL
address
3GD8TbPZJzHrTug2p6sKcBpe1HLxzxtXdU
transaction
106674001ecbe565a4a1e0b1c628ebfa800886310a556f72620abe3f1acf01d2
spent
true